#7b1bf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b1bf0 is composed of 48.2% red, 10.6%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 267 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 52.4%. #7b1bf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#f636ff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#7b1bf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010b is the darkest color, while #fbf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b1bf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858289 is the less saturated color, while #7a12f9 is the most saturated one.
